Debunking the Rumors

Recently, a hashtag #RIPCartoonNetwork trended on Twitter, fueled by speculations of layoffs at Warner Bros. However, these reports lack confirmation, and we must wait for official updates.

 

Concerns and Criticisms

David Zaslav, the CEO and President of Warner Bros Discovery, has faced criticism for decisions unpopular among the masses. The merger of CN Studios into WB Animation has raised concerns among fans.

 

 Cartoon Network Speaks Up

In an official statement on Twitter, Cartoon Network assured fans, saying, “Y’all we’re not dead, we’re just turning 30😂. We have been and will always be your home for beloved, innovative cartoons⬛️⬜️More to come soon!” This lighthearted message brought relief to many.

 

Fan Reactions

Fans flooded the comments section with congratulatory messages, celebrating Cartoon Network’s enduring presence. The positive response drowned out negativity, for now. The future will reveal how this merger unfolds.
